I have a 2001 S4. I'm wondering what might be the cause of the following ....

After starting the car and moving forward (whether in gear or neutral), the car will roll smoothly for 5-10 feet and then there is a feeling of rolling-resistance (for lack of better word). It's like going over a small speed bump (not the bounce but the resistance). It's just for a second or two and then back to smooth rolling. It doesn't happen again for as long as the engine is on. If I turn off the engine, start the car again, it will happen exactly the same every time. Perfectly reproduceable. (By the way, it doesn't happen when rolling in reverse. It only happens the first time rolling forward after starting the engine).

My mechanic is a bit stumped. He says it is like some pump is being triggered and once it's triggered, every thing operates as it should. He's just not sure what pump it might be.

Any experience with this or thoughts about it?
